USF announces 2023 Alumni Award recipients. Two USF Muma College of Business grads are among the distinguished honorees selected for a 2023 Alumni Award. J. Michelle Childs ('88, Management) is a circuit judge for the U.S. Court of Appeals. Steve Presley ('90, Accounting) is executive vice president and CEO, North America, for Nestlé.
Olympic gold medalist Evelyne Viens ('19, Accounting) was selected for induction into the USF Athletic Hall of Fame Class of 2023. Viens played on the USF women's soccer team from 2016 to 2019.
USF Bulls land new careers after tax season internships at Kerkering Barberio. The accounting internship program at Kerkering Barberio provides an exciting opportunity to gain hands-on experience for future tax and accounting professionals during the busiest time of the year. This year, six USF interns accepted employment offers from Kerkering Barberio.
